Although matching AT&T makes it look more attractive, you still end up paying a lot more for your phone, as opposed to the 2 yr subsidized More Everything plan where you can get a new 16 gb 5s for $199.99. I got a new 32 gb 5c free. With Edge, you end up paying the full price and then some. If you upgrade early, you have to trade in your smartphone to Verizon, which has always been the case with Edge. In addition, you also have to pay off 50 percent of their current phone's full retail price. The base iPhone 5S costs $650, so if you wanted to trade that phone in for the next Galaxy S smartphone, you would be on the hook for $325. Edge is not the smartest deal, but may be all some people can manage financially by making payments.
 
I'd rather do the 2 yr subsidized contract like I've been doing for several years. I liked getting that 32 gb 5c for my wife free.
